Overview:

We are seeking a Senior Project Controls Staff Member to lead the project controls efforts for phase 1 of the Government Computing Facility (GCF) project. The GCF Project is a strategic partnership aimed at the design and construction of a state-of-the-art classified computing facility. This project represents a significant investment in advancing the capabilities of government computing, providing the necessary infrastructure to support high-level classified research and development to support data analysis. This position resides in the Project Management Office in the Laboratory Director's Directorate atOak Ridge National Laboratory(ORNL).

Major Duties/Responsibilities:

This position will function as the project controls lead and is responsible for developing and implementing comprehensive project control strategies that ensure alignment with overall project objectives and budget targets. The project controls lead will collaborate closely with project leadership and cross-functional teams to develop a cost and schedule baseline, track performance, identify and manage risks, manage change requests, and enforce compliance with DOE and ORNL requirements. This will include:

  • Development/maintenance of project work breakdown structure (WBS) and dictionary.
  • Development/maintenance of detailed, logic driven, resource loaded schedules.
  • Development/maintenance of summary and detailed cost estimates.
  • Risk identification and management, to include Monte Carlo simulations.
  • Change control management.
  • Preparation of various status and Earned Value Management (EVM) based reports. Ensure all project management systems, project planning and project executions are compliant with applicable ORNL and DOE governance.
  • Project management process and systems training for all applicable project staff, specifically the technical control account managers (CAMs).
  • Support for various project reviews, including project status reviews, stage gate reviews, and earned value system surveillance/compliance reviews.

Basic Qualifications:

  • BS/BA in project or construction management, business, engineering or equivalent combination of education, experience, and specialized training will be considered.
  • 10years of experience successfully performing project controls duties as noted above for research-based project(s) within the DOE or Department of Defense (DOD).
  • 10years of project experience working within an EVMS environment compliant with EIA- 748; to include setting baselines, incorporating baseline changes, producing monthly reports and variance analysis.
  • Complete understanding of project controls best practices regarding scope, time, cost, change management and a complete understanding of DOE Order 413.3b and EIA-748 compliant EVM.
  • Significant hands-on experience with: Oracle Primavera, Deltek Cobra or similar cost processors, change control applications, and custom system and report development.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Project Management Professional (PMP) certification, or equivalent project management certification.
  • Experience with risk management, working with risk analysis and simulation software.
  • Experience as a Project Controls Lead on a large project.
  • MS in project or construction management, business, engineering or equivalent.
  • Fifteen years of experience successfully performing project controls duties as noted above for research-based or construction project(s) within the DOE Office of Science within a national laboratory environment.
  • Fifteen years of project experience working within an EVMS environment compliant with EIA-748.
  • Experience with conventional facilities construction or High-Performance Computing projects.
  • Experience in training on project management principles or tools, specifically CAM training.

Security, Credentialing, and Eligibility Requirements:

  • This position requires the ability to obtain and maintain an HSPD-12 PIV badge.
  • For employment at Oak Ridge National Laboratory (ORNL), a Real ID compliant form of identification will be required.
  • Additionally, ORNL is subject to Department of Energy (DOE) access restrictions. All employees must also be able to obtain and maintain a federal Personal Identity Verification (PIV) card as mandated by Homeland Security Presidential Directive 12 (HSPD-12) and Department of Energy (DOE) Order 473.1A, which requires a favorable post-employment background investigation.
  • To obtain this credential, new employees must successfully complete and pass a Federal Tier 1 background check investigation. This investigation includes a declaration of illegal drug activities, including use, supply, possession, or manufacture within the last year. This includes marijuana and cannabis derivatives, which are still considered illegal under federal law, regardless of state laws.
